Canyon Meadows is an CTrain LRT station in SW Calgary, it was opened in 2001 as part of the South LRT Extension on the Calgary Transit Red Line. The fire alarm system is from 2016.

System Specifications

FACP

The building is protected by an EST QuickStart QS1 addressable fire alarm system. The panel is located in an electrical room next to the elevator on the platform level. The system runs EST's Signature-series addressable protocol, and the system coding is temporal. fire alarm panel is an EST QuickStart QS1 (addressable) which is not visible from the public area. However, there is 1 EST QSA-1-F (flush mount) annunciator on the upper level near the exit.

Annunciators

There is an EST QSA-1-C annunciator at the main entrance, with an EST QS1-CPU-1 annunciator and an EST SL30 zone annunciation card inside.

Notification Appliances

All notification appliances are EST "Genesis" G1R-HDVM horn/strobes (red, wall-mount, no lettering, set to 15cd) mounted on EST G1TR trim plates.

Initiating Devices

Pull Stations

All pull stations are EST SIGA-270 addressable single action pull stations.

Automatic Detection Devices

There are EST SIGA2-PS addressable photoelectric smoke detectors throughout the station, mounted on EST SIGA-SB bases.
